Dear Christophe,
Thanks for the feedback. We have continued to work with your program,
and we have found (and fixed) TWO extra bugs in the marshaler. Yves
Jaradin has found the subtlest one: missing parentheses in a macro
definition :p Now your program completes without crashing!
The bug fixes are in the svn trunk (rev. 16939). Enjoy!
Cheers,
raph
Christophe Taton wrote:
Dear Raphael,
I checked for the latest revision r16938 and made sure I had no bad
interaction with some other previous version.
I tried on two different machines (one gentoo linux and one ubuntu
linux) and I am still getting the glibc error. On the laptop, I also get
a backtrace :
*** glibc detected ***
/home/taton/Mozart/install-r16938-20080418/platform/linux-i486/emulator.exe:
double free or corruption (!prev): 0x082ccb40 ***
======= Backtrace: =========
/lib/tls/i686/cmov/libc.so.6[0xb7cc3a85]
/lib/tls/i686/cmov/libc.so.6(cfree+0x90)[0xb7cc74f0]
/home/taton/Mozart/install-r16938-20080418/platform/linux-i486/emulator.exe(_ZN5Stack6resizeEi+0x15f)[0x806709f]
Cheers,
Christophe
On Thu, Apr 17, 2008 at 4:09 PM, Raphael Collet
<[EMAIL PROTECTED] <mailto:[EMAIL PROTECTED]>> wrote:
Christophe,
Please make sure to test revision 16938, because my first patch was
not correct... This patch is "saner".
Cheers,
raph
------------------------------------------------------------------------
_________________________________________________________________________________
mozart-users mailing list
[email protected]
http://www.mozart-oz.org/mailman/listinfo/mozart-users
_________________________________________________________________________________
mozart-users mailing list
[email protected]
http://www.mozart-oz.org/mailman/listinfo/mozart-users